● When Bound Originals is selected,
the original orientation will be
automatically set. As the original
orientation will be set as Head to
Top when Left Page Then Right or
Right Page then Left is selected,
and as Head to Left when Top
Page Then Bottom is selected, be
sure to load your documents
correctly.
● For details on image orientation,
refer to "5.14 Specifying Image
Orientation".
● To cancel any setting, select Cancel.
2
Select Bound Originals on the Added Features screen.
The Bound Originals (Scan Order) screen is displayed.
3
Select the Bound Originals option and the pages of the bound
document to be copied.
Here, we will illustrate by selecting Left Page Then Right and Both Pages.
If Left Page Only or Right Page Only is selected, only the image on the left
pages or the right pages will be copied as a page image in the scanned order.
4
To specify Binding Erase, use
5
Check the orientation of the document.
6
Select Save to specify settings for other features if necessary.
7
Using the keypad, enter the number of copies desired and
then press Start on the control panel.
Copies will be made.
